You need to enable JavaScript to run this app.
导航
AddIpAddressPoolCidrBlock
最近更新时间:2024.10.11 17:03:30首次发布时间:2024.09.06 10:16:24

调用 AddIpAddressPoolCidrBlock 接口,向指定IP地址池中添加IP地址网段。

调用说明

  • 不支持添加已占用的IP地址网段。
  • 已欠费关停的IP地址池,无法添加IP地址段。

调试

请求参数

参数名称
类型
是否必选
示例值
描述
ActionStringAddIpAddressPoolCidrBlock要执行的操作,取值:AddIpAddressPoolCidrBlock
VersionString2020-04-01API的版本信息,当前版本为2020-04-01。

CidrBlock

String

101.0.XX.XX/24

IP 地址网段。仅支持IPv4地址段,且不能以0开头,掩码取值范围:23~30。

说明

仅支持配置 CidrBlockCidrMask其中之一。

CidrMask

Integer

24

IP 地址网段掩码,取值范围:24~28。输入掩码后,IP 地址网段将自动分配。

说明

仅支持配置 CidrBlockCidrMask其中之一。

IpAddressPoolId

String

ippool-fda83op****

IP 地址池的 ID。
您可以调用 DescribeIpAddressPools 接口,查询IP地址池的ID。

ClientToken

String

123e4567-e89b-12d3-a456-42665544****

保证请求幂等性。由客户端自动生成一个参数值,确保不同请求间该参数值唯一,避免当调用API超时或服务器内部错误时,客户端多次重试导致重复性操作。取值:

  • 仅支持ASCII字符,且不能超过64个字符。

返回数据

参数名称
类型
示例值
描述
RequestIdString2021062415303314515207C4****请求ID。
CidrBlockString101.0.XX.XX/24IP 地址网段。

请求示例

GET /?Action=AddIpAddressPoolCidrBlock&Version=2020-04-01&CidrBlock=101.0.XX.XX/24&IpAddressPoolId=ippool-fda83op**** HTTP/1.1
Host: open.volcengineapi.com
Service: vpc
Region: cn-beijing

返回示例

{
    "ResponseMetadata": {
        "RequestId": "20210624153033015207C4****",
        "Action": "CreateIpAddressPool",
        "Version": "2020-04-01",
        "Service": "vpc",
        "Region": "cn-beijing"
    },
    "Result":{
         "RequestId": "2021062415303314515207C4****",
         "CidrBlock": "101.0.XX.XX/24"
     }
}

错误码

公共错误码,请参见 公共错误码 。

HttpCode
错误码
错误信息
描述
400IdempotentParameterMismatchArguments on this idempotent request are inconsistent with arguments used in previous request(s).此幂等请求的参数与前一个请求中使用的参数不一致。
InvalidCidr.MalformedThe specified cidr block is malformed.指定的网段格式不合法。
InvalidIPPool.CidrBlockResourceNotEnougThere is not enough CIDR block resource to create an IP address pool.可用网段资源不足无法创建IP地址池。
InvalidIPPool.InvalidStatusThe specified IP address pool is not in the correct status for the request.指定IP地址池所处的状态无法响应该请求。
InvalidIPPoolCidrBlock.MalformedThe specified CIDR block is malformed. The mask length must be greater than or equal to 23 and less than or equal to 30.指定的网段不合法,网段掩码必须大于等于23且小于等于30。
InvalidIPPoolCidrBlock.NotSupportIPv6The IP address pool does not support IPv6 CIDR block.IP地址池不支持指定IPv6网段。
InvalidIPPoolCidrMask.MalformedThe specified CIDR mask is malformed. The mask length must be greater than or equal to 24 and less than or equal to 28.指定的掩码不合法,掩码必须大于等于24且小于等于28。
InvalidParameterA parameter specified in the request is not valid, is unsupported or cannot be used.该请求传入了非法或不支持的参数。
InvalidParameter.ClientTokenMalformedThe specified parameter ClientToken is malformed.指定的参数ClientToken格式不合法,长度不能超过64个ASCII字符。
QuotaExceeded.IPPoolIPYou've reached the limit on the number of IPs of all IP address pools that you can possess.已达到所有IP地址池持有IP地址数量上限。
404InvalidIPPool.NotFoundThe specified IP address pool does not exist.指定的IP地址池不存在。
412IdempotentProcessingThe request uses the same client token as a previous one that is still in process.幂等请求处理中。